Output d6d624cb112faf6b16a06bca3083513448296e00e6abbf108d1fdac7b25c6c98:21

value
1006866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b70645b011126c7c9a44e779640be47914a0269d OP_EQUAL
address
3JNm6T4EgbkoqkYEJt8bm5qQj5HaLcSdHX
transaction
d6d624cb112faf6b16a06bca3083513448296e00e6abbf108d1fdac7b25c6c98
spent
true